Cutting through the confusing jargon frequently used to describe single malts, this book, now fully up to date, replaces it with an objective and easily applied guide to taste the usage of a new flavor profile

 
Rigorously researched with the cooperation of the whisky industry, this classification of single malt whiskies by flavor has been totally revised and up to date to include all of the newest single malts from the United Kingdom and Ireland. The writer has identified 12 dimensions to the aroma and taste of a single malt whisky: body, sweetness, smoky, medicinal, tobacco, honey, spicy, winey, nutty, malty, fruity, and floral. For this edition, the writer has also up to date the taste profiles for Every selected malt and reviewed previous entries to make sure that this book remains the definitive guide to tasting malt whisky. Every entry includes a short description of the distillery, information for visitors, the writer’s own tasting notes, and his flavor profiles in keeping with this innovative classification. The history of whisky-making and production methods are clearly explained, as is learn how to organize a whisky tasting.
